What Is American Diamond?
American Diamond is a premium diamond simulant crafted to visually resemble a natural diamond. While it is not chemically identical to a mined diamond, its brilliance, fire, and clarity are designed to closely match the look of fine diamonds.
Key Characteristics
- Exceptional sparkle and light reflection
- Clear, colorless appearance
- Affordable luxury aesthetic
- Available in multiple cuts and settings
Ethical Concerns with Natural Diamonds
The diamond industry has long faced scrutiny over ethical issues, including conflict mining, unsafe labor practices, and environmental damage. Despite improvements, concerns remain.
Major Ethical Challenges
- Conflict diamonds funding violence
- Unsafe mining conditions
- Land and ecosystem destruction
- Water pollution and carbon emissions
Why Ethics Matter to Modern Buyers
Consumers today want transparency. Jewelry is no longer just about status—it is about responsibility. American Diamond eliminates mining-related ethical risks entirely.
Why American Diamond Is Budget-Friendly
One of the strongest advantages of American Diamond is cost. A comparable natural diamond can cost 10–20 times more than an American Diamond of similar visual size.
| Feature | American Diamond | Natural Diamond |
|---|---|---|
| Price | Highly affordable | Very expensive |
| Ethical Risk | None | Possible |
| Visual Appeal | Excellent | Excellent |
Real-Life Budget Example
A bridal necklace set in natural diamonds may cost the same as multiple American Diamond jewelry sets, allowing buyers to enjoy variety without compromise.

Durability & Everyday Wear
American Diamonds are suitable for occasional and regular wear when cared for properly. While they may not match the hardness of natural diamonds, modern manufacturing ensures excellent resistance to chipping and clouding.
Best Use Scenarios
- Wedding functions
- Festive jewelry
- Fashion-forward daily wear
- Travel jewelry

American Diamond Care & Maintenance Guide
Daily Care Tips
- Store separately
- Avoid harsh chemicals
- Clean with mild soap
Cleaning Steps
- Soak in warm soapy water
- Gently brush with soft bristles
- Rinse and dry with soft cloth
